N2 - This article reviews and advances existing literature concerning wearable sensor-based devices, mobile biometric and sentiment data, and workplace collaboration software. In this research, previous findings were cumulated showing that generative artificial intelligence and emotion recognition tools can streamline operational workflows, forecast job displacement, and shape talent surplus, leading to productive workplace in immersive work environments. Throughout May 2023, a quantitative literature review of the Web of Science, Scopus, and ProQuest data-bases was performed, with search terms including “immersive digital and virtual office spaces” + “employee monitoring software,” “wearable sensor-based devices,” and “generative artificial intelligence and virtual communication and collaboration tools.” As research published in 2023 was inspected, only 166 articles satisfied the eligibility criteria, and 49 mainly empirical sources were selected. Data visualization tools: Dimensions (bibliometric mapping) and VOS viewer (layout algorithms). Reporting quality assessment tool: PRISMA. Methodological quality assessment tools include: AXIS, MMAT, ROBIS, and SRDR.
